Sam Altman Net Worth: How the OpenAI CEO Built His Fortune
Sam Altman is an American entrepreneur, investor, and the CEO and co-founder of OpenAI, the company behind ChatGPT. Unlike many technology executives, Altman does not own direct equity in OpenAI, meaning his personal fortune is largely separate from the company’s enormous valuation.
Sam Altman Net Worth
As of 2026, estimates of Sam Altman’s net worth vary depending on which investments and valuations are included. Forbes estimated his fortune at more than $4 billion in May 2026, after previously estimating it at around $3.3 billion. A September 2026 Forbes profile puts his estimated net worth at approximately $3.3 billion.
The difference reflects the difficulty of valuing private-company investments. Altman owns stakes in several privately held businesses, and their values can change significantly between funding rounds and other transactions.
Does Sam Altman Own OpenAI?
One of the most interesting facts about Altman’s wealth is that he does not have a direct ownership stake in OpenAI. Despite leading the company through its enormous growth, his fortune has primarily come from investments he made in other technology companies and venture funds.
OpenAI itself has reached extraordinary private-market valuations. In 2026, reports said the company was valued at hundreds of billions of dollars, with a potential future funding round being discussed at an even higher valuation. However, OpenAI’s valuation does not translate directly into personal wealth for Altman because he does not hold direct equity in the company.
How Did Sam Altman Make His Money?
Altman began building his wealth long before becoming the public face of OpenAI. He founded Loopt, joined Y Combinator, and later became president of the startup accelerator. During his time in Silicon Valley, he invested in numerous technology companies and startups.
His investment portfolio has included companies such as Reddit, Stripe, Helion Energy and Retro Biosciences. These investments became important sources of his personal wealth.
Helion Energy Investment
One of Altman’s most valuable investments is Helion Energy, a company developing fusion energy technology. Forbes reported in 2026 that Altman’s stake in Helion was worth approximately $1.65 billion based on the valuation used in its analysis.
Altman has also invested in other companies working in areas such as artificial intelligence, biotechnology and financial technology.
Sam Altman’s Salary
Altman’s wealth is not primarily the result of a large executive salary. Fortune reported that his OpenAI salary has historically been around $76,000 per year, while his much larger fortune has come from investments.
This makes his financial story unusual compared with CEOs whose wealth is closely connected to company stock ownership.
Sam Altman’s Investments
Altman’s investment portfolio has included a wide range of technology companies and startups. Court documents discussed in 2026 revealed that he held more than $2 billion in stakes in companies that had business relationships with OpenAI, including Helion Energy, Stripe and Retro Biosciences.
These investments demonstrate why estimating his wealth is complicated. Many of the companies are private, so their valuations can change based on investment rounds and other transactions.
